An Empirical Investigation of Sampling Strategies in Marital Research.
Karney, Benjamin R.
Journal of Marriage and the Family, v57 n4 p909-20 Nov 1995
Addresses the lack of data on procedures used to recruit subjects in marital research by examining the effects of different sampling techniques. In Study One, couples recruited through newspaper advertisements were found to be at greater risk for marital discord. In Study Two, couples who responded to mailed solicitation were found to be less traditional and of higher socioeconomic status. (JPS)
